
A town that still calls itself an engineering town
Walk along Dysart Road or past the old Spittlegate works and Grantham announces itself, quietly but persistently, as an engineering town. The name Hornsby appears on heritage boards; the civic memory of the firm that once employed 2,000 people here — and built one of the world's first commercial oil diesel engines — sits close to the surface of the town's sense of itself. Aveling-Barford's road-making machinery reached construction sites on several continents. The identity is not manufactured nostalgia; it was earned over generations.
The job listings tell a different story. At any given moment, around 58 engineering roles appear in Grantham on specialist boards — of which 39 are part-time and 19 temporary. That is not the labour market of an engineering town. It is the thin, casualised residue of one.
The gap between what a place believes itself to be and what its economy actually provides for working people is rarely comfortable to examine. What does it mean when a town's industrial identity outlives the industrial employment that created it — and is that identity an asset, a distraction, or something more complicated still?
What made Grantham an engineering town
The Great Northern Railway reached Grantham in 1852, and its significance was less romantic than practical: it placed a landlocked Lincolnshire market town within reach of national supply chains and export routes that made large-scale manufacturing commercially viable. Hornsby's and, later, Aveling-Barford were not cottage industries that grew gradually outward — they were heavy operations anchored to ironwork, foundry casting, and precision machining that required a constant throughput of skilled labour.
That labour reproduced itself through apprenticeships. The Spittlegate industrial heartland generated multi-generational training pipelines: a craftsman taught his trade to an apprentice who in turn became a craftsman teaching another. The mechanism was structural rather than sentimental. Grantham's technical workforce stayed in Grantham because the work was there, the skills transferred within the local economy, and the employment was permanent and full-time. This is what sustained an engineering identity — not because engineering was celebrated, but because it was the dominant form of work, and the town organised around it accordingly.
Aveling-Barford extended this employment base well into the mid-20th century, adding export-facing product lines — road rollers, motorgraders, dump trucks — that connected Spittlegate output to construction projects far beyond Britain. What both firms shared, beyond geography, was the quality of what they made: precision and foundry work that built durable, specialist expertise across the local labour pool. That kind of expertise takes generations to assemble, which is precisely why its dismantling, when it came, proved so difficult to reverse.
How the industrial model broke down
Three distinct pressures dismantled that self-sustaining system, and none of them operated in isolation.
Corporate consolidation came first. As ownership of Grantham's anchor firms passed to conglomerates with interests well beyond Lincolnshire, the decisions that shaped investment, workforce scale, and product lines moved away from the town. Rationalisation followed logically — not out of malice but out of indifference to local consequence. A boardroom in Birmingham or London has little reason to weigh the Spittlegate apprenticeship pipeline when cutting capacity.
Global competition then exposed what consolidation had left vulnerable. Capital-heavy foundry operations that had not modernised faced price pressure from overseas manufacturers with substantially lower cost bases. By the 1970s, Grantham's heavy engineering was caught between owners with limited local commitment and markets that no longer protected domestic production.
The deindustrialisation waves of the 1970s and 1990s sharpened the damage. The policy environment under Margaret Thatcher — herself born on North Parade in Grantham — accelerated manufacturing's contraction, though the pressures driving that contraction were already well established before 1979 and continued long after 1990. What mattered most, structurally, was not any single administration's choices but the breaking of the apprenticeship pipeline. Once multi-generational technical training stopped, the expertise it produced stopped accumulating. Jobs could theoretically be replaced; a skills base dismantled over two decades cannot be rebuilt in one.
What filled the space on industrial estates such as Alma Park was work of a different character: light manufacturing, distribution, packaging, food processing. Employment, certainly — but not the kind that rebuilds a precision skills base or matches the wages that foundry and heavy engineering work once commanded.
What the current job market actually looks like
The composition of those vacancies matters as much as their number. A market skewing so heavily toward part-time and temporary contracts is not a quirk of timing or a snapshot distortion — it reflects a casualised structure that would be unrecognisable to anyone who worked at Hornsby's or Aveling-Barford. Permanent, full-time engineering employment sustained multi-generational households; fixed-term plant maintenance cover does not reproduce that stability.
The most prominent local engineering employer is now BGB Engineering on Dysart Road, established in 1976 and currently employing approximately 100 to 125 people. BGB manufactures slip rings and fibre optic rotary joints — precision rotary transmission products used in global wind energy and specialist industrial applications. It holds the Queen's Award for Enterprise and, by any reasonable measure, is a genuinely capable precision manufacturer. What it is not is a structural replacement for the employment density of earlier anchor firms: 100–125 people against Hornsby's historical peak of 2,000 illustrates, without further comment, the scale of contraction.
Salary data for the active specialist market reinforces the scarcity reading. Maintenance and multi-skilled engineer roles attract £40,000–£60,000 per year; controls and design engineers £45,000–£60,000; field service engineers £35,000–£50,000 and above. These are competitive figures — but they reflect restricted supply rather than a thriving market. When qualified candidates are thin on the ground, the few available specialist roles command higher rates by default. That premium is a symptom of thinness, not evidence of engineering vitality.
The forces making the gap harder to close
Two structural dynamics are actively widening the gap rather than closing it, and they operate through quite different mechanisms.
The first is a straightforward deterioration in the employment base. ONS data shows South Kesteven's employment rate falling from 72.4% (year ending December 2022) to 66.2% (year ending December 2023) — well below the East Midlands regional rate of 75.5%. Around 2,700 residents aged 16 and over were unemployed, a 4.4% rate. The ONS figures dismantle any assumption that Grantham holds a latent pool of workers ready to fill engineering roles as they appear. Unemployment and underemployment are genuinely elevated; redirecting surplus labour into technical roles is not a simple policy lever to pull.
The second force runs in the opposite direction. Grantham's position on the East Coast Main Line — London King's Cross approximately 65 to 70 minutes away — makes the town an attractive residential base for people whose working lives are elsewhere. Skilled residents and technically trained graduates commute to higher-paying roles in Peterborough, Nottingham, and London rather than accepting what the local market can offer. The result is a continuous structural drain on the technically capable end of the local workforce: the very people that advanced engineering employers need most are the ones with the strongest incentive to leave every morning.
The two forces compound each other in ways that are difficult to interrupt. One extracts skilled workers outward; the other leaves those who remain in a market that does not rebuild their technical capacity. South Kesteven's GVA per job sits approximately 20% below the national average, and economic assessments of the district point to a negligible higher-level skills base — the foundation that any expansion of advanced manufacturing would require. That is the double bind: a falling employment rate that cannot absorb displaced workers, and a commuter dynamic that removes precisely the skilled people local engineering most needs.
Small-scale responses to a decades-long deficit
The institutional responses to this deficit are real and, in the local context, they matter. BGB Engineering's partnership with Grantham College and West Grantham Academy — producing apprentices and T-Level placements, and earning BGB a College Employer of the Year award — represents exactly the kind of employer-led pipeline investment that regional strategy documents typically call for. Across Lincolnshire more broadly, Lincoln UTC's combined work-and-study engineering programme, the Lincolnshire Institute of Technology's employer-partnership model, and the CATCH process manufacturing hub each address specific technical gaps in the regional supply of qualified candidates.
None of this is token effort. These programmes create visible pathways into technical work where, for much of the past three decades, none existed in any organised form.
The problem is one of proportion. A structural deficit assembled across several decades of deindustrialisation, corporate consolidation, and apprenticeship pipeline collapse cannot be closed by a T-Level cohort or a handful of completions per year, however well-designed those schemes are. Grantham's engineering identity continues to shape how the town thinks about itself — its history, its streets, its civic self-description. But the labour market that identity implies does not yet exist in the form the heritage suggests: it is thin, casualised, and constrained in ways that incremental training provision, however necessary, cannot independently reverse.
For residents navigating education or employment decisions, and for anyone involved in local policy, that distinction is the more useful starting point: not what Grantham once was, but an accurate reading of what the market currently is.
